Output 6d893c2ae63c0ed3a93982e1bf05ab3a3067d9c8331826df09d5f5264af31dfb:144

value
1933514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27b97aa74174dd8437a12a239c7531ad4fa6252c OP_EQUAL
address
35K4ULfri6pfwuU6MYs3eXPZ3EzTVE9Dhy
transaction
6d893c2ae63c0ed3a93982e1bf05ab3a3067d9c8331826df09d5f5264af31dfb
confirmations
342049
spent
true